Summary of the contracting process

NHS England has completed a public procurement process to enhance diabetes data standards, collaborating with industry leaders to improve healthcare services. The process, initiated under UKPGA 2023/54 legal basis, focuses on creating standards for diabetes data and improving data-sharing practices across clinical systems. The contract is titled "Diabetes data standards - Industry Technology Data Information Standard" and categorised under health services. The buyer and main contracting authority, NHS England, is headquartered in London, UK. This direct procurement process, conducted below threshold values without competition, was awarded to the supplier "Diabetes data standards - Industry Technology Data Information Standard", based in Kent, UK. The contract runs from 16 January 2026 to 16 June 2026, with a gross value of GBP 115,807.

Notice Description

We have awarded a contract to develop the next phase of diabetes data standards, building on the success of the existing Diabetes Information Standard. We will work with PRSB and the diabetes technology industry, represented by ABHI, to create a data-sharing standard and associated code of practice for patient-initiated data. This work will establish regulatory guidance for storing, using and sharing patient-initiated records, and develop templates and system requirements to enable clinicians to receive relevant patient-generated data directly into their clinical systems. The resulting data flows will support improved clinical decision-making, patient-initiated follow-up, stratification approaches and the reduction of unnecessary outpatient activity. In partnership with the NHS England IOPs team, we will pilot new interoperability approaches that can serve as a model for wider NHS adoption. This programme will support patients to share their data with their care teams more effectively and enhance diabetes management across services.
